Dick's Sporting Goods Park in Commerce City, Colorado, is the home of the Colorado Rapids and one of MLS's original soccer-specific stadiums in the Rocky Mountain region. The stadium sits at elevation with views of the Front Range, and the supporters' sections create an atmosphere that handles Colorado's variable weather with covered seating and passionate fan culture. Match nights draw a crowd that reflects Denver's outdoor-loving, craft-beer identity. For the Rapids, Commerce City is the permanent home after years of searching for the right Denver-area site.
Dick's Sporting Goods Park opened in 2007, giving the Rapids a purpose-built home after years at Invesco Field at Mile High's cavernous expanse. It hosted the 2007 MLS All-Star Game and multiple U.S. Open Cup matches. The stadium's design by HOK prioritized mountain views and supporter culture. Dick's Sporting Goods' naming deal tied the venue to a Colorado-born retail brand with deep local roots.
